The effect of environmental factors on wood anatomy of Corylus maxima Mill. taxons

In this study, anatomical studies were performed to examine the effects of environmental factors on Corylus maxima Mill. taxon wood belonging to Betulaceae members growing in the Black Sea Region. The wood samples for investigation have been taken altitude 0-500 m from Artvin, Rize, Trabzon, Giresun, Ordu, Samsun, Sinop, Kastamonu, Bartın, Zonguldak, Düzce, Sakarya and Kocaeli to reveal anatomical datas. The anatomical characters of wood samples and anatomical differences between each other are basis of our research. In anatomical structure, trahes (tangential and radial diameters, lengthes of vessel elements and the number of vessels per mm2), rays (number of ray per mm, length and width of ray), fibers (length of fiber, width of fiber, width of lumen, fiber wall thickness), axial parenchyma and pseudorays have been researched. All results of datas have been analyzed with statistical methods.
